The "Big Table" Problem: Why Banks Stumble

When you walk into a major national bank, you aren't just a client; you’re a file number in a massive, slow-moving machine. These institutions have layers of bureaucracy that make a simple renovation loan feel like a government hearing.

The industry average for a mortgage closing in 2026 is still hovering around 40 to 45 days. That’s over six weeks of "hurry up and wait." Why does it take so long?

  • Rigid Underwriting: Big banks have "one-size-fits-all" rules. If your situation is even slightly unique, say you’re self-employed or looking at a unique luxury property, their systems often glitch, causing weeks of delays.
  • The 9-to-5 Grind: Real estate doesn't happen between 9:00 AM and 5:00 PM. Offers are made on Saturday nights. Problems are discovered on Sunday mornings. If your loan officer is "out of the office" until Monday, you’ve already lost 48 hours.
  • Documentation Redundancy: Ever sent the same bank statement three times? Big banks are notorious for "lost" paperwork and redundant requests that reset your clock.

Ditch the Drama: The Fast Track to Your New Front Door

If you want to beat the big banks and secure a fast mortgage closing in Atlanta, there are a few "power moves" you can make to help us help you:

  1. Get a "Full" Pre-Approval: Don’t settle for a basic pre-qualification. We want to run your credit (just once, because we're brokers, we can shop multiple lenders with one pull!) and review your docs upfront. This makes you look like a "cash buyer" in the eyes of a seller.
  2. Order the Appraisal Early: In a busy market, the appraisal is often the bottleneck. We push to get this scheduled the moment you’re under contract.
  3. Stay Responsive: When we ask for a document, try to get it to us within a few hours rather than a few days. In the world of mortgage speed, every hour counts.
  4. Work with a Local Expert: A local lender knows the Atlanta neighborhoods, the local taxes, and the specific quirks of Georgia real estate law.

Will my credit score be impacted if I shop for multiple mortgage rates?
As a broker, we typically only need to pull your credit once. That single pull can be used to shop across our network of lenders, protecting your score while finding you the best possible rate.
